Using a UI Bundle Template

Before building a Salesforce React UI bundle app from scratch, offer the user a prebuilt starter template. The Salesforce CLI generates these — a complete, deployable SFDX project (React UI bundle + toolchain + an npm run setup automation) — in one command. Starting from a starter is faster and less error-prone than hand-scaffolding.

The CLI command is sf template generate project.

Step 1: Offer the choice

The following are the templates. Ask the user which one fits, or whether they want to start from scratch.

Template--template flagBest for
Internal starterreactinternalappStarter for internal, employee-facing Salesforce apps (e.g. support consoles, ops dashboards, internal admin apps) — users are already-authenticated employees. Includes Agentforce chat. No login flow or public.
External starterreactexternalappStarter for customer/partner-facing Salesforce apps/sites (e.g. portals, communities, storefront, public sites). Full auth support (login, registration, reset, profile) -- external users sign in with their own accounts.

If the user prefers to start from scratch (or neither fits), stop here and let experience-ui-bundle-app-coordinate scaffold a new project. This skill is opt-in — do not force a template.

Step 2: Generate the project into the target root

The project contents must land directly at the target root `$DEST` — so sfdx-project.json sits at $DEST/sfdx-project.json, with no extra wrapper subfolder. sf template generate project always nests its output under a --name subfolder, so generate into the $DEST dir, then move the contents from the subfolder up into $DEST, overwriting anything already there on conflict. Remove the empty subfolder at the end.

  • <SKILL_DIR> = the absolute path to this skill's own directory — the folder containing this SKILL.md; resolve it from the skill path in context
  • `$NAME` — the project name (alphanumerical only — no spaces, hyphens, underscores, or special characters). Ask the user for it. It also names the UI bundle, so it shows up inside the project.
  • `$DEST` — the target root directory the contents land in (use . for the current directory).
sh
NAME=MyApp   # project name the user chose; also names the UI bundle
DEST=.       # target root directory (the contents land directly here, no NAME/ wrapper)

# choose ONE template flag based on the user's pick from Step 1
TEMPLATE=reactinternalapp   # or reactexternalapp

mkdir -p "$DEST"
sf template generate project --name "$NAME" --template "$TEMPLATE" --output-dir "$DEST"

# Flatten the generated $DEST/$NAME contents up into $DEST (see <SKILL_DIR>/scripts/flatten-project.mjs).
# Use the absolute skill-dir path — a relative ./scripts/ would resolve against $DEST, not the skill.
node "<SKILL_DIR>/scripts/flatten-project.mjs" "$DEST/$NAME" "$DEST"
rm -rf "$DEST/$NAME"
<SKILL_DIR>/scripts/flatten-project.mjs moves every generated entry (incl. dotfiles) into $DEST, overwriting any existing file/dir of any type on conflict while preserving unrelated files the user already had in $DEST. The per-entry rmSync + renameSync is what guarantees the template's files win on conflict (including a file-vs-directory type mismatch).

Verify

After generation, confirm the contents landed at the root (not in a $NAME/ subfolder):

sh
test -f "$DEST/sfdx-project.json" && echo "OK: project root landed" || echo "FAILED"

sfdx-project.json must sit at $DEST/sfdx-project.json. The project also contains package.json, force-app/main/default/uiBundles/$NAME/ (the React/Vite bundle), scripts/, config/, and README.md. If sfdx-project.json is missing or is one level down in $DEST/$NAME/, the flatten did not run — re-check before continuing.

Step 3: Install dependencies (you do this — do NOT hand off uninstalled)

If the generated project ships without node_modules, install dependencies yourself before handing the project back — a fresh template is not runnable (preview/build/lint all fail) until deps are present. The user should receive a ready-to-develop project.

There are multiple package.json files, each needing its own install:

  • the project root ($DEST/package.json), and
  • the UI bundle dir under $DEST/force-app/main/default/uiBundles/$NAME/ — this holds the toolchain the preview server loads, so it must have node_modules too.
sh
# 1. project root ($DEST was set in Step 2)
( cd "$DEST" && npm install )

# 2. each UI bundle
for b in "$DEST"/force-app/main/default/uiBundles/*/; do
  [ -f "$b/package.json" ] && ( cd "$b" && npm install )
done
First-run install of the bundle is the heavy step (tailwind, radix-ui, recharts, vite, etc.); expect a short wait. If an install fails, surface it — don't hand off a half-installed project.

Step 4: Confirm and hand off

Verify the project landed and is installed:

sh
ls "$DEST" # sfdx-project.json, package.json, force-app/, scripts/, README.md ...
ls "$DEST"/force-app/main/default/uiBundles/*/node_modules >/dev/null && echo "bundle deps installed"

The project is now ready to develop and deploy. If there's a README.md in the template, take a look at it to see if there is any extra step or guidance for the user.

From here, continue development with the other ui-bundle skills (experience-ui-bundle-frontend-generate, experience-ui-bundle-salesforce-data-access, experience-ui-bundle-deploy, etc.) against the now-scaffolded project — scaffolding and dependency install are already done.

Notes

  • The starters are minimal — no seeded sample data or custom objects. Build the rest with the other ui-bundle skills.
  • These templates use the uiBundles metadata convention. The UI bundle directory and meta XML are named after the project name you pass to --name.
  • sf template generate project --help lists all available templates if the flag names ever change.
